A native of the Dominican Republic, Mrs. Ostria is a strategic, creative and results oriented leader with great success in organizational development and management of non-profit organizations and programs. Her professional experience stems from over 25 years of providing problem-solving solutions to operational challenges characteristics of non-profit entities to organizations and programs of all sizes. Areas of expertise include finance and operations, grants management, strategic planning, business development, project design and implementation and capacity building. Over the last decade, Mrs. Ostria has supported small non-profits with strategic planning processes, program development and implementation, and strengthening organizational capacity.

In 2019, she led the production of a bilingual (English/Spanish)
interactive story map that used interviews with local residents to
describe the evolution of the Latino community in Adams Morgan; a neighborhood in Washington, DC. Two years later, Mrs. Ostria secured the funding that led to the reproduction of the keepsake in digital form.

She joined C4AA in the summer of 2021 as Assistant Director for Finance & Operations, overseeing Finance, Human Resources, and Business Operations.

Mrs. Ostria received her B.A. in Economics from INTEC (Santo Domingo) and her master’s degree in Latin American Studies and Finance from The George Washington University. In addition, she holds a certificate from the Harvard School of Business in Strategic Management of Non-Profits.
